.bbinsights-team{background:#f2f4f7;padding:7rem 4rem}.bbinsights-team__grid,.bbinsights-team__header{margin-left:auto;margin-right:auto;max-width:1080px}.bbinsights-team__header{margin-bottom:4rem}.bbinsights-team__label{color:#fe6625;font-size:.72rem;font-weight:700;letter-spacing:.14em;margin-bottom:.6rem;text-transform:uppercase}.bbinsights-team__title{color:#003d59;font-family:Raleway,sans-serif;font-size:clamp(2rem,4vw,3rem);font-weight:700;line-height:1.15;margin-bottom:.75rem}.bbinsights-team__sub{color:#9da5be;font-size:1rem;font-weight:300;line-height:1.75;max-width:700px}.bbinsights-team__grid{column-gap:5rem;display:flex;flex-wrap:wrap;justify-content:center;margin:0 auto;max-width:1080px;row-gap:4rem}.bbinsights-team__card{background:#fff;border-radius:20px;box-shadow:0 4px 20px rgba(0,0,0,.08);display:flex;flex-direction:column;flex-shrink:0;overflow:hidden;transition:transform .3s,box-shadow .3s;width:300px}.bbinsights-team__card:hover{box-shadow:0 18px 44px rgba(0,0,0,.14);transform:translateY(-7px)}.bbinsights-card__top{background:#fff;display:flex;flex-direction:column;flex-shrink:0;height:160px;overflow:hidden;padding:1.3rem 1.4rem 1.1rem}.bbinsights-card__eyebrow{color:#003d59;flex-shrink:0;font-size:.68rem;font-weight:700;letter-spacing:.08em;line-height:1.4;margin-bottom:.5rem;min-height:1.904rem;opacity:.65;text-transform:uppercase}.bbinsights-card__name{color:#111;font-family:Raleway,sans-serif;font-size:1.75rem;font-weight:900;line-height:1.25;margin:auto 0 0}.bbinsights-card__photo{background:var(--card-color,#003d59);flex-shrink:0;height:250px;overflow:hidden;position:relative}.bbinsights-card__photo img{display:block;height:100%;object-fit:cover;object-position:top center;width:100%}.bbinsights-card__linkedin{align-items:center;background:#fff;border-radius:50%;bottom:1rem;box-shadow:0 2px 10px rgba(0,0,0,.25);display:inline-flex;height:36px;justify-content:center;left:1rem;position:absolute;text-decoration:none;transition:background .2s,transform .2s;width:36px}.bbinsights-card__linkedin:hover{background:#fe6625;transform:scale(1.1)}.bbinsights-card__linkedin svg{fill:#003d59;height:16px;width:16px}.bbinsights-card__linkedin:hover svg{fill:#fff}@media (max-width:768px){.bbinsights-team{padding:5rem 1.5rem}}@media (max-width:1160px){.bbinsights-team__card{width:250px}}@media (max-width:740px){.bbinsights-team__card{width:220px}.bbinsights-team__grid{column-gap:1.5rem;row-gap:2.5rem}}@media (max-width:480px){.bbinsights-team__card{width:290px}.bbinsights-team__grid{column-gap:0}}